marquesan tattoo photo gallery The hardest one na toa marquesan
The hardest one so far because of the tattoo motifs that cover the body, based on tattoo patterns recorded by Kramer and others in the early 1900s. Most often the old photos show a simple unmarked malo (loincloth). The weapon is the well-known marquesan club. Also distinctive is the two-top-knot shaved head, almost comical to western eyes..

marquesan tattoo photo gallery Figure 8.10/1. Sitting Badora's Leg Tattoos. Figures 8.10/1-2, page 181
Figure 8.10/1. Sitting etua hypostasized mata hoata. Badora's leg tattoos: (a) mata hoata ; (b) double kake ; (c) mata hoata ; (d) kautupa ; (e) Etua ; (f) mata hoata ; (g) double kake ; (h) poriri. Source : Von den Steinen, i. 132, illus. 77 Reproduced in Gell (1998:181), "Style and Culture", Art and Agency: An Anthropological Theory. see also: Great Diagrams in Anthropology, Linguistics, and Social Theory.

marquesan tattoo photo gallery FIG. 8.10/4. From Figures 8.10/3-4, page 181
FIG. 8.10/4. From mata hoata to the Vau rock motif by the addition of spirals. Source : Von den Steinen, i. 169, illus. 125 FIG. 8.10/3. The mata hoata tattoo indicated tends evidently toward the etua motif. Source : Von den Steinen, i. 104, illus. 54 Reproduced in Gell (1998:182-83), "Style and Culture", Art and Agency: An Anthropological Theory. see also: Great Diagrams in Anthropology, Linguistics, and Social Theory.
